在Element UI的el-table组件中,el-table-column本身并不直接支持设置高度属性。不过,我们可以通过一些间接的方法来调整el-table-column的高度。以下是一些详细的方法和说明: 1. 设置行高来间接影响列高 虽然el-table-column没有直接的高度属性,但我们可以通过设置行高来间接影响列的高度。这可以通过row-style属性来实...
固定表头。只要设置了属性,就会自动固定表头 max-height 数值 位表格设置最大高度 el-table-column的属性 属性 属性值 说明 fixed true(默认;左)|left|right 固定栏,滚动的时候会浮动起来,可以选择浮在哪一边 如果我们希望通过行内的一些属性来对行做不同的显示,那么我们可以给el-table添加row-class-name属性。...
el-table中如果el-table-column加了v-if动态显示列导致位置错乱或者el-table__body-wrapper的高度小于容器高度的解决方案 在隐藏列显示之后,执行: this.$nextTick(()=>{this.$refs.table.doLayout();});
2、在computed计算当前内容高度,通过 this.$nextTick() 方法 回调重新获取DOM更新后的高度,并通过toggleHight事件传递当前子组件内容高度给父组件 (this.$nextTick()会在DOM 更新循环之后执行然后等待 DOM 更新) 在父组件methods中定义table标签中调用的方法 /**childClick、tableRowClassName、tableRowStyle、rowClick...
elementui的table与自适应高度 2019-11-25 10:34 −element官方文档中的table高度都是用的 height="250" 来定义了table固定高度,实际中很多时候我们需要使表格来自适应某个div,所以height一般不能让它为一个固定高度,下面看代码 <div ref="tableCot"> <el-table ... ...
通过在el-table-column中使用v-if指令,我们可以实现一些高度动态化的操作。比如,根据用户的权限来判断是否显示某一列,或者根据某一状态值来决定是否展示特定的列内容。 需要注意的是,在使用v-if指令控制el-table-column列的显示和隐藏时,我们需要确保条件表达式的准确性和有效性。否则,在表格渲染时可能会产生意想不...
elementui的table与自适应高度 2019-11-25 10:34 −element官方文档中的table高度都是用的 height="250" 来定义了table固定高度,实际中很多时候我们需要使表格来自适应某个div,所以height一般不能让它为一个固定高度,下面看代码 <div ref="tableCot"> <el-table ... ...
elementui的table与自适应高度 2019-11-25 10:34 −element官方文档中的table高度都是用的 height="250" 来定义了table固定高度,实际中很多时候我们需要使表格来自适应某个div,所以height一般不能让它为一个固定高度,下面看代码 <div ref="tableCot"> <el-table ... ...
elementui的table与自适应高度 2019-11-25 10:34 −element官方文档中的table高度都是用的 height="250" 来定义了table固定高度,实际中很多时候我们需要使表格来自适应某个div,所以height一般不能让它为一个固定高度,下面看代码 <div ref="tableCot"> <el-table ... ...